Регулярное выражение в gsub

BARRY BRADLEY

Известный
Автор темы
711
176
Версия MoonLoader
.026-beta
Lua:
local text = "Строка TEST ID 228: текст"
local randString = "[gg]" -- строка может содержать регулярные выражения, но не всегда
local text = text:gsub("TEST", randString)
print(text)
Как в gsub игнорировать регулярные выражения

UPD:
Lua:
-- // Экранирование
function escape_magic(s)
  return (s:gsub('[%^%$%(%)%%%.%[%]%*%+%-%?]','%%%1'))
end
 
Последнее редактирование: